Output 71780c34f81ea4e880349f29c99c1d431c19b623b769a1ebbcf6c94cd703a5d1:0

value
170008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e65712ef60f9949d6cfa7c80d86cfe191c9e9ec OP_EQUAL
address
3G8YDB7h18WyB7JLU3okH88Fj4jBD8ejMM
transaction
71780c34f81ea4e880349f29c99c1d431c19b623b769a1ebbcf6c94cd703a5d1
confirmations
229480
spent
true